Property Highlights: - An ideal entry into the market or renovator's project packed with potential - Convenient Wallsend location mere moments to shopping, schooling and services - Rear lane access to a double garage, plus a large workshop area - Fujitsu split system air conditioning to the living and main bedroom, plus a ceiling fan - Timber flooring and Venetian blinds throughout - A living area set at the entrance to the home, plus a sunroom off the main bedroom - Spacious kitchen featuring 40mm benchtops, a tiled splashback, a built-in pantry and a freestanding Chef oven - Two bedrooms, both with built-in wardrobes for convenient storage - Bathroom featuring a built-in bath and shower combination, a vanity and a separate WC Outgoings: Council rates: $2,248 approx. per annum Water rates: $963.93 approx. per annum Rental Return: $xxx approx. per week Presenting an exciting opportunity in a convenient Wallsend location, this brick, weatherboard and Colorbond roof residence offers endless potential on a low maintenance 354.1sqm parcel of land, perfect for first home buyers or renovators seeking their next project. Positioned for everyday convenience, this address places Wallsend Village for shopping and essential services, plus local schooling only moments from home. Newcastle's CBD and its iconic coastline, along with the shores of Lake Macquarie, are all easily accessible, ensuring work, weekends and lifestyle needs are well catered for. Arriving at the property, a low maintenance front yard and a covered front verandah provide a warm welcome before stepping inside, where timber flooring and Venetian blinds provide a great foundation for future updates and the opportunity to further enhance over time. Set at the entrance of the home, the living area provides a comfortable space to relax, complete with Fujitsu split system air conditioning for year round comfort. Two bedrooms are on offer, with the main bedroom featuring a built-in wardrobe, a ceiling fan with a light, Fujitsu split system air conditioning and access to an adjoining sunroom. The second bedroom also comes with a built-in wardrobe for convenient storage. Servicing the home, the bathroom offers a built-in bath and shower combination, a vanity and a separate WC for extra functionality. The spacious kitchen features 40mm benchtops, a tiled splashback, a built-in pantry and a freestanding Chef oven with a cooktop. Outside, the covered alfresco area adds further versatility before leading to a major highlight of the property. Accessed via the rear lane, the large double garage delivers fantastic vehicle accommodation and storage, plus there is a spacious workshop area which also provides exciting potential to transform into extra living space if desired. Offering a rare combination of location, shedding and future opportunity, this Wallsend property provides an outstanding option for renovators, investors and buyers seeking space in a highly convenient setting.
